Just curious what y pipe are people using for ebay headers? I've been looking at the tsp y along with the flowtech and edelbrock. However most y's have flanges or are flared out on the end. Are people just cutting those pieces off and adding?

I figured I may be able to save some cash for the budget if I did the ebay headers and off road y. However after calling around today I could only get quotes of around $140 for a y pipe which is about what tsp is with shipping. After crunching the numbers tho I came out with
185=headers
40=o2 extensions
140=y pipe
__________
365=system
or for about a hundred more I can do either a complete pacesetter or bbk system from a sponsor, have it be reputable, and fitment will be hopeefully top notch

Just have one made. The flowmaster merge is the best you can get, just pick one up, and have them fab a 3" y. It will flow great compared to most y's, though TSP just put a flowmaster style merge on theirs.
